Susan Hundley, 61 of Marmet passed away suddenly Sunday March 3, 2019 at Hubbard Hospice House, Charleston after an unexpected illness.
She was a graduate of East Bank High School, Carver Career Center and The University of Charleston. She retired after 35 years of service as a RN first assistant.
